Lewiston is a city and the county seat of Nez Perce County, Idaho, United States, in the state's north central region. [3] It is the third-largest city in the northern Idaho region, behind Post Falls and Coeur d'Alene , and the twelfth-largest in the state.
It is one of Idaho's oldest towns and, through the Snake River, its only seaport. In 1860's the town enjoyed a boom when gold was found in the region and in 1863-1865 it served as the state capital. The Turner Hotel, at 140-170 E. Jackson St. in Mountain Home, Idaho, was built in 1899.It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1984. [1]It is a three-story flat-roofed commercial block building, seven bays long along its east side and 11 bays long along its south side.
